Precise motion platform with vibration dampers

The invention provides a precise motion platform with vibration dampers. The precise motion platform comprises a base, a miscropositioner, vibration dampers, horizontal motors and vertical motors, wherein the number of the vibration dampers is three or more than three, the vibration dampers are positioned between the base and the miscropositioner in a polygon form to support the miscropositioner, the number of the horizontal motors and the vertical motors is respectively three or more than three, and the horizontal motors and the vertical motors are positioned between the base seat and the miscropositioner, and are distributed along a circular path to be staggered with the vibration dampers for actively controlling the position and the speed of the miscropositioner in the horizontal direction and the vertical direction. According to the precious motion platform with the vibration dampers, provided by the invention, the vibration dampers and the motors are separately designed, thereby the design freedom of degree is achieved and the cost is reduced. Aerostatic bearings are applied to the structures of the vibration dampers, and no interval sealing is needed, thereby the requirements on manufacturing accuracy and the manufacturing cost are decreased.

Active electric power-assisting circulation ball type steering system

The invention relates to an active electric power-assisting circulation ball type steering system, comprising a steering column tube assembly, a screw rod moving device, a circulation ball type steering device, an electric power-assisting device and an automatic control module. A steering column tube is connected with the upper part of a screw rod of the circulation ball type steering device through a sliding spline, and the electric power-assisting device is connected with the lower part of the screw rod through a sliding spline; the screw rod moving device is sleeved on the screw rod; the screw rod has two motion freedoms; a freedom of rotating around the axis is controlled by a steering wheel; and the other freedom of moving along the axis is controlled by a screw rod moving control motor; a steering nut is moved by overlapping the effects of rotation and axial movement of the screw rod, so that a transmission ratio of the steering system is changed in real time, and the active steering is intervened. The steering system not only can meet the requirements on lightness and high sensitivity at a low-speed steering process and on stable operation at a high-speed steering process, but also has the characteristics of security, compact structure, low cost and the like. The active electric power-assisting circulation ball type steering system is applicable to a medium/light passenger bus and a lorry.

Special-shaped display panel and display device

The invention discloses a special-shaped display panel and a display device. The outline of a display area of the special-shaped display panel comprises at least one arc edge, and the special-shaped display panel comprises multiple data lines extending in the first direction and multiple scanning lines extending in the second direction; the special-shaped display panel comprises multiple display pixel lines, and each display pixel line comprises display pixels distributed in the second direction; at least one display pixel line exist, and display pixel lines are connected with the arc edges in an adjacent mode; one first display pixel exists in one display pixel connected with the corresponding edge in an adjacent mode, the spacing between the first display pixels and the arc edges is smaller than that of any other display pixels in the display pixel line and the arc edges, the area of the first display pixel is larger than that of any other display pixels in the display pixel line. According to the scheme, by increasing the size of the display pixels in the special-shaped area properly, the requirement of the manufacturing precision is lowered, the manufacturing yield of the special-shaped display panel is increased conveniently, and the manufacturing efficiency of the special-shaped display panel is improved conveniently.

Flexible substrate

The invention provides a flexible substrate. The flexible substrate comprises a polymer substrate and a plurality of barrier layers arranged on the polymer substrate. A planarization layer is arranged between adjacent barrier layer, each planarization layer comprises a plurality of planarization units which separate from one another in first and second directions, an included angle between the first direction and the second direction is 0 DEG-180 DEG, projections of the planarization units in the planarization layers on the substrate cover a gap between the projections of the planarization units on adjacent planarization layers, and projection areas partially overlap. Therefore, adjacent planarization layers can mutually cover position of the gap between the planarization units to stop transverse penetration of water and oxygen, the flexible substrate can be trimmed by optional size in a size range larger than the planarization units, large-scale production of the flexible substrate can be achieved, process step is simplified, and production cost is reduced. Thickness of odd layers and even layers in the planarization layers is decreased progressively in a direction far away from the substrate sequentially, and accordingly low roughness of the top surface of the flexible substrate is guaranteed and the flexible substrate is suitable for manufacturing of organic photoelectric devices.

System and method for measuring aspheric interference based on reference surface of spatial light modulator

The invention proposes a system and a method for measuring aspheric interference based on reference surface of a spatial light modulator, relating to an interferometry system and an interferometry method for measuring the aspheric surface shape and belonging to the field of photoelectric detection. The measuring system of the invention comprises a laser, a collimating objective, a spectroscope, a reference lens, a compensator, a to-be-measured aspheric surface, an imaging objective and a CCD detector. The SLM is used as the reference lens for an aspheric interferometry system, defined as an SLM reference lens. The present invention also discloses a measuring method using an aspheric interferometry system. The technical problem to be solved in the present invention is to generate a non-planar wavefront equal to a partially compensated aspheric wavefront and achieves zero-interference measurement. While the system and the method inherit the advantages of the partially compensating method that requires lower precision on the designing and manufacturing of the compensator, the advantage of high accuracy of the zero-compensation interferometry method is also maintained. In addition, it is possible to avoid the introduction of mechanical phase shift error in a traditional interferometry system.
